#860415 Color
#860415 is rgb(134, 4, 21) in RGB, hsl(352, 94%, 27%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 97%, 84%, 47%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is UP Maroon (#7B1113),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.09.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#860415 Channel Values
How #860415 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 134 · G 4 · B 21 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 352° · S 94% · L 27%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 352° · S 97% · V 53%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 97% · Y 84% · K 47%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 10.28:1 vs white · 2.04: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#860415 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#860415 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#860415?
#860415 is a dark red — rgb(134, 4, 21) in RGB and hsl(352, 94%, 27%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is UP Maroon (#7B1113),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.09.
What is the RGB value of #860415?
#860415 is rgb(134, 4, 21) — red 134, green 4, and blue 21 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#860415?
#860415 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 97%, 84%, 47%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#860415 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#860415 scores 10.28:1 against white and 2.04: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#860415 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#860415 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is maroon (#800000) at a CIE76 distance of 7.99,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
